A&M Starts Second Half of SWAC Slate by Visiting UAPB

Game Notes

NORMAL  – Just as the Southwestern Athletic Conference season started on the road, Alabama A&M opens the second half of its SWAC schedule, Saturday night with a visit to Arkansas Pine-Bluff at the H.O Clemmons Arena in Pine Bluff, Ark at 7:30 p.m.

Third year Head Coach Willie Hayes, (8-11, 5-4 SWAC) had stumbled to UAPB earlier in the season 72-64, but is above .500 in the first half of league play. The Bulldogs defeated Prairie View A&M 67-55 at home in their last outing.

Arkansas-Pine Bluff (6-15, 4-5 SWAC) lost five straight games after opening its conference slate with two straight victories. Since then, the Lions have defeated Valley, by five points and scored a road win on "The Hill.

Alabama A&M's primary goals this season have been to play solid team defense, win the rebounding battle, and be efficient on offense. The Bulldogs have allowed only seven teams to score as many as 70 points and two to shoot 50 percent from the floor. A&M  has a +4.4 edge in rebounding for the season and has won that battle in 13 games.
 
The Bulldogs rank No. 4 in the conference in scoring defense (68.1 ppg) and has held 11 opponents under 40 percent from the field.

Two Bulldogs' are averaging double figures in scoring, led by 5-8 senior Jeremy Crutcher, of Hazel Green, Ala., who is averaging 13.1 points per game and dishing out 6.5 assists  per contest (6th in the SWAC). Demarquelle Tabb, a 6-2 senior from Greensboro, Ala., averages close to 10 points per game, and is 10th in the league in rebounding.
 
Marcel Mosley, of UAPB collected a game-high 19 points, six rebounds, six assist and seven steals as the UAPB topped Jackson State 70-69 Monday night.
